Temperature level Considerations



When it concerns industrial outside painting, temperature level plays a crucial role in the end result of your task. If you're repainting in extreme warm, the paint can dry out as well quickly, bring about concerns like bad attachment and irregular finishes. You want to aim for temperature levels in between 50 ° F and 85 ° F for the very best results. Below 50 ° F, paint might not treat correctly, while above 85 ° F, you risk blistering and breaking.

Timing your project with the right temperatures is important. Beginning your work early in the early morning or later in the mid-day when it's cooler, especially throughout warm months.

Also, think about the surface temperature level; it can be significantly more than the air temperature level, specifically on warm days. Make use of a surface area thermostat to examine this prior to you begin.

If multifamily painters are uncertain, keep an eye on the weather forecast. Sudden temperature level decreases or heat waves can derail your strategies. You do not intend to begin repainting just to have the problems transform mid-project.

Humidity Levels



Moisture degrees significantly impact the success of your business exterior painting task. When the humidity is too expensive, it can prevent paint drying out and healing, resulting in a range of problems like bad bond and end up quality.



If you're intending a job during damp conditions, you might find that the paint takes longer to dry, which can prolong your project timeline and boost costs.

Alternatively, low moisture can also position difficulties. Paint may dry as well promptly, stopping proper application and leading to an uneven coating.

You'll intend to keep track of the moisture degrees carefully to ensure you're working within the ideal variety, usually between 40% and 70%.

Rainfall Impact



Rain or snow can substantially interrupt your commercial outside paint strategies. When rainfall occurs, it can remove fresh applied paint or produce an irregular finish. Preferably, you intend to select days with completely dry climate to guarantee the paint adheres correctly and cures efficiently. If you're captured in a rain shower, it's best to stop the task and await conditions to boost.
